Flutter tap recorder widget

import 'package:flutter/gestures.dart'; | |
import 'package:flutter/material.dart'; | |
import 'package:flutter/rendering.dart'; | |
import 'package:flutter/scheduler.dart'; | |
import 'package:flutter/widgets.dart'; | |
/// This is code that I (https://twitter.com/creativemaybeno) wrote for a | |
/// StackOverflow answer. | |
/// You can find it here: https://stackoverflow.com/a/65067655/6509751. | |
/// List of the taps recorded by [TapRecorder]. | |
/// | |
/// This is only a make-shift solution of course. This will only be viable | |
/// when using a single [TapRecorder] because it is saved as a top-level | |
/// variable. | |
@visibleForTesting | |
final recordedTaps = <Offset>[]; | |
/// These are the parameters for the visualization of the recorded taps. | |
const _tapRadius = 15.0, | |
_tapDuration = Duration(milliseconds: 420), | |
_tapColor = Colors.white, | |
_shadowColor = Colors.black, | |
_shadowElevation = 2.0; | |
/// Widget that records any taps that hit its child. | |
/// | |
/// It does not matter to this widget whether the child accepts the hit events. | |
/// Everything hitting the rect of the child will be recorded. | |
/// | |
/// It will both visualize them and add them to [recordedTaps]. | |
class TapRecorder extends SingleChildRenderObjectWidget { | |
const TapRecorder({Key? key, required Widget child}) : super(child: child); | |
@override | |
RenderObject createRenderObject(BuildContext context) { | |
return _RenderTapRecorder(); | |
} | |
} | |
class _RenderTapRecorder extends RenderProxyBox with _SilentTickerProvider { | |
final _recordedTaps = <_RecordedTap>[]; | |
@override | |
void detach() { | |
for (final recordedTap in _recordedTaps) { | |
(recordedTap.animation as AnimationController).dispose(); | |
} | |
_recordedTaps.clear(); | |
super.detach(); | |
} | |
@override | |
bool hitTest(BoxHitTestResult result, {required Offset position}) { | |
if (!size.contains(position)) return false; | |
// We always want to add a hit test entry for ourselves as we want to react | |
// to each and every hit event. | |
result.add(BoxHitTestEntry(this, position)); | |
return hitTestChildren(result, position: position); | |
} | |
@override | |
void handleEvent(PointerEvent event, covariant HitTestEntry entry) { | |
// We do not want to interfere in the gesture arena, which is why we are not | |
// using regular tap recognizers. Instead, we handle it ourselves and always | |
// react to the hit events (ignoring the gesture arena). | |
if (event is PointerDownEvent) { | |
// Records the global position. | |
recordedTaps.add(event.position); | |
final controller = AnimationController( | |
vsync: this, | |
duration: _tapDuration, | |
), | |
recordedTap = _RecordedTap(event.localPosition, controller); | |
_recordedTaps.add(recordedTap); | |
controller | |
..addListener(markNeedsPaint) | |
..addStatusListener((status) { | |
if (status == AnimationStatus.completed) { | |
controller.dispose(); | |
_recordedTaps.remove(recordedTap); | |
} | |
}) | |
..forward(); | |
} | |
} | |
@override | |
void paint(PaintingContext context, Offset offset) { | |
context.paintChild(child!, offset); | |
final canvas = context.canvas; | |
for (final tap in _recordedTaps) { | |
final path = Path() | |
..addOval( | |
Rect.fromCircle(center: tap.localPosition, radius: _tapRadius)); | |
final opacity = 1 - tap.animation.value; | |
canvas.drawShadow( | |
path, _shadowColor.withOpacity(opacity), _shadowElevation, true); | |
canvas.drawPath(path, Paint()..color = _tapColor.withOpacity(opacity)); | |
} | |
} | |
} | |
class _RecordedTap { | |
_RecordedTap(this.localPosition, this.animation); | |
final Offset localPosition; | |
final Animation<double> animation; | |
} | |
/// Ticker provider that does not perform any diagnostics. | |
/// | |
/// We trust that the [_RenderTapRecorder] instance will dispose all tickers | |
/// by disposing the animation controllers. | |
mixin _SilentTickerProvider implements TickerProvider { | |
@override | |
Ticker createTicker(TickerCallback onTick) => Ticker(onTick); | |
} |
